Do I Need Brakes on My Trailer? NZ Trailer Brake Rules Explained
Does my trailer need brakes? We get asked this constantly, usually by someone standing at the counter who has just bought a trailer and isn't sure what they're allowed to tow with it.
The answer comes down to one number: what the trailer weighs fully loaded. Not the size of it, and not what you're towing it with.
First, the three types of brake
The rules use three terms and they mean quite different things.
- Service brake. The trailer's main brake, the one that slows it down as you drive alongside your tow vehicle's brakes. This is what people mean when they say "trailer brakes". It has to act on each wheel of at least one axle, and the whole combination has to pull up within 7 metres from 30km/h.
- Parking brake. Holds the trailer once it's parked or unhitched, same job as the handbrake in your car. It has to act on at least one complete axle, and either stop the trailer within 18 metres from 30km/h or hold it on a 1-in-5 slope.
- Breakaway brake. Emergency only. If the trailer comes off the tow vehicle, it applies the trailer's brakes off its own battery so the thing stops instead of running loose.
The weight thresholds
Everything hangs off gross laden weight: the trailer plus whatever you've put on it. Read the bands carefully, because a trailer sitting at exactly 2,500kg falls in the top one, not the middle.
| Gross laden weight | Service brake (main driving brake) |
Parking brake | Safety chains |
|---|---|---|---|
| 2,000kg or less | Not required. If you fit one anyway, it has to act on each wheel of at least one axle | Not required | One, or a breakaway brake instead |
| More than 2,000kg but less than 2,500kg | Required. Direct or indirect, either is fine | Not required | Two, or a breakaway brake instead |
| 2,500kg or more | Required. Direct or indirect, but an indirect brake has to comply with UN/ECE Regulation No.13 | Required | Two, or a breakaway brake instead |
Safety chains and breakaway brakes
These are alternatives to each other, which catches a lot of people out. The rule wants an adequately rated coupling with safety chains, or a breakaway brake. You don't necessarily need both.
Most trailers on our roads sit in the lightest band and need one chain. Over 2,000kg it's two, and the rule is fussy about them: they have to meet Australian Design Rule 62, and they have to cross each other when connected. Crossed chains cradle the drawbar if the coupling lets go instead of letting it dig into the road.
Check your shackles while you're down there. Rated shackles only. Hardware store shackles aren't up to it and they're a common weak point.
Laden weight isn't tare weight
This one catches people out regularly. A tandem box trailer might weigh 600kg empty but be rated to 2,500kg laden. It's the rating, and what you actually load on, that sets your obligations. How heavy it feels when it's empty has nothing to do with it.
Your trailer's plate, usually riveted to the drawbar or chassis, shows the rated capacity. If it's missing or you can't read it, sort that before your next WoF.
Override brakes or electric brakes?
If your trailer needs a service brake, there are two common ways to do it here.
Override (surge) brakes are self-contained, and they're what the rules call an indirect system. As you slow, the trailer's momentum pushes it up against the coupling and that movement applies the brakes, either mechanically or hydraulically. Nothing to wire into the tow vehicle, which is why they're so common on boat and utility trailers.
Electric brakes are a direct system. A controller applies the trailer brakes in proportion to how hard the tow vehicle is braking. You get finer control, you can dial the braking effort up or down, and they behave better on a long descent. That used to mean a controller hard-wired into the dash, but Bluetooth units like Elecbrakes mount on the trailer and run off your phone, so nothing gets permanently fitted to the vehicle and you can tow with a different ute without rewiring anything.
Coupling ratings: why 2,500kg is the line
This is the bit that causes the most argument at the counter, so here's the exact wording.
A trailer over 2,000kg has to have a coupling system that has a manufacturer's load rating equal to or greater than the laden weight of the trailer. That's the legal test, straight out of the rule. Your coupling's rating isn't a recommendation.
Standard hydraulic override couplings sold in New Zealand top out at 2,500kg. That's a limit of the hardware, not a rule about override braking in general. And watch the boundary: at exactly 2,500kg laden you're already in the top band, so an indirect brake has to meet UN/ECE Reg 13.
At 2,500kg and up you've got two options, and most people only know about the first one.
1. A 3,500kg coupling with electric brakes
A coupling body rated to 3,500kg, electric brakes on the axles, and a controller. Worth knowing that this style of coupling doesn't brake anything itself. It's rated for the weight, and the electric brakes do the work.
2. An ECER13 certified override system, no electrics at all
An indirect system certified to UN/ECE Reg 13 is allowed right up to 3,500kg. Here that generally means a Knott system, where the coupling and the mechanical drum brakes are certified together as a matched set.
It's the same setup Ifor Williams and Brian James use to build 3,500kg trailers with no brake controller anywhere in the vehicle. No electronics to fail, no controller to fit, no hydraulics to service, and you can hitch it to any suitably rated vehicle without touching the wiring.

Why you'll hear conflicting advice on this
Because the rule changed. The Light-vehicle Brakes Amendment 2019 came into force on 1 June 2019, and the whole point of it was to let trailers between 2,500kg and 3,500kg run indirect service brakes as well as direct ones. Before that you couldn't really do it without an exemption.
So if someone tells you override braking is banned over 2,500kg, they're working off what was true up until 2019. What hasn't changed is the practical bit: if your trailer is rated at 2,500kg or more and you've got an ordinary hydraulic override coupling on it, that coupling isn't rated for the job.
Keeping a braked trailer legal
Brakes only count if they work. What usually fails a trailer at WoF time is seized calipers, scored or badly corroded discs, pads that are thin or oil-contaminated, perished hydraulic hoses, and breakaway batteries that won't hold charge. Boat trailers are the worst of them, for obvious reasons.
If you're giving yours a once-over, check pad thickness is even side to side, the caliper slides freely, there's nothing weeping at the hose ends, and the override coupling feels firm when you compress it.
Where to check the official rules
The above comes from Land Transport Rule: Light-vehicle Brakes 2002, as amended by the Light-vehicle Brakes Amendment 2019 (Rule 32014/2002/5), plus NZTA's own guidance. Rules change and some trailer types have extra requirements, so check the source for your own trailer:
